PCGamesN is a British website with articles about PC gaming and hardware.
Parent company Network N was founded by James Binns (formerly ofFuture Publishing) in late May 2012.[1][2][3]PCGamesN launched the following month.[4]
PCGamesN's first website was designed to host traditional games coverage alongside aggregated and user-created content,[1] which was presented to the reader in channels dedicated to major gaming franchises. Over the course of two redesigns since launch, it has evolved to fully embrace a more traditional approach, and now produces original coverage across the gamut ofPC games and hardware.
The launch team included Tim Edwards, former editor ofPC Gamer.[1]PCGamesN added ten new channels and two new writers for a total of seven staff writers in August 2012.[5] The website added editorial staff fromGamesMaster[6] and theOfficial PlayStation Magazine in 2015,[7] most notably neweditor-in-chief Joel Gregory. Gregory brought in staff fromEdge magazine andKotaku UK in 2017,[8] concluded the site's transition away from its experimental first form, and oversaw a redesign, unveiling PCGamesN's current layout in August 2018.[9] Network N Media has since launched updated versions of its other owned sites:The Loadout,Pocket Tactics,Wargamer,The Digital Fix, andCustom PC.[10]
Ben Maxwell took over as editor of PCGamesN in May 2018, before stepping up to a new leadership role within the publishing group in November 2020. He was succeeded in 2020 by Richard Scott-Jones. In 2023, Cameron Bald was appointed Editor of PCGamesN.[11]
